Is it possible to obtain an electronic copy of the judicial record certificate in Panama?

Currently, the Judicial Branch of Panama does not issue electronic copies of the judicial record certificate. However, you can obtain a physical copy of the certificate and, if necessary, scan or digitize it to present it in electronic format, as long as the requirements are met and the authenticity of the document is preserved.

What are the legal obligations of financial institutions when conducting background checks for their clients in Costa Rica?

Financial institutions in Costa Rica have a legal obligation to perform background checks for their clients. This is done to guarantee the integrity of the financial system and prevent illicit activities, safeguarding the security of transactions.

How are judicial files handled in the Mexican justice system?

Judicial files in the Mexican justice system are handled in a careful and orderly manner. They are recorded, archived and preserved in accordance with established procedures. Physical records are stored in secure facilities and digital documents are managed through document management systems. The control and integrity of files are essential for the administration of justice.

What are the options available for Paraguayans who want to start a business in the United States, either starting their own business or participating in investment programs?

Paraguayans interested in starting a business in the United States can explore options such as the E-2 Investor Visa, which allows individuals from countries with trade agreements to invest and operate businesses. Additionally, they can consider specific investment programs that facilitate participation in commercial and economic development projects.

What legislation regulates the crime of workplace violence in Guatemala?

In Guatemala, the crime of workplace violence is regulated in the Penal Code and in the Law for the Comprehensive Protection of Women. These laws establish sanctions for those who exercise physical, psychological or sexual violence in the workplace, creating a hostile environment or harming the integrity and well-being of workers. The legislation seeks to prevent and punish workplace violence, promoting safe, respectful and violence-free work environments.
